Calling All Women Sailors: WOW WAH Regatta August 22-23

A Two Day Regatta for Women Sailors, the WOW WAH, in Marina del Rey for all-women crews and coed crews with a woman at the helm.

WOW WAH! Women On the Water, Women At the Helm Regatta August 22-23, 2015

The largest women’s regatta in Marina del Rey is back! Registration for the WOW WAH—Women on the Water and Woman at the Helm—is now open for the event which will take place Saturday and Sunday August 22 and 23.

The WOW-WAH has a 37-year history of promoting women’s sailing, encouraging women to take the helm for sailing and racing.

“The WOW-WAH is all about empowering woman not only to race, but to take charge at the helm,” says Jana Davis, Regatta Chair. “So many in our community are looking for a chance to get on a boat and race. I encourage any skipper and boat owner, man or woman, to get a crew together and take this great opportunity to help a wanna-be-skipper to get out of her comfort zone and take up the challenge..”

Three categories make up the regatta. The WOW is for all-women crews, the WAH is mixed, but must have a woman at the helm. These two divisions will buoy race. The third group is a Cruising Class of WOW or WAH crews which will race random leg courses.

Prestigious take-home trophies will be awarded in each division.

Registration for the event is up now and ready at www.regattanetwork.com

For Davis, who is the Race Chair for the Women’s Sailing Association of Santa Monica Bay, an event sponsor, the WOW-WAH holds a special meaning. “It was my first regatta--ever. A boat needed more women and all I had to do was be ready and willing to learn. I’ve been a part of the sailing and racing community ever since and will always be grateful to WOW-WAH.”

The largest women’s regatta in Marina del Rey, the WOW-WAH attracts competitive teams as well as teams just banding together for the weekend, says Davis. “The common thread,” she adds, “is that everyone comes ready to have a great time. And as you’ll find out at the post-race celebrations, it’s all worth it.”

The regatta includes an after-race party and raffle on Saturday at Pacific Mariners Yacht Club and trophy celebrations on Sunday at Santa Monica Windjammers Yacht Club.

Sponsoring organizations include the Association of Santa Monica Bay Yacht Clubs, Women’s Sailing Association of Santa Monica Bay, South Bay Yacht Racing Club, Pacific Mariners YC, Marina Venice YC, California YC, Del Ray YC and Santa Monica Windjammers YC.
